This report details Eclypsium's discovery of a new CondiBot variant and a Go-based 'Monaco' SSH scanner/Monero miner that target a wide range of architectures and network/edge devices. The malware uses multiple download methods, disables reboots and watchdogs, kills competing bots, brute-forces SSH with a large credential list, and reports compromised credentials and mining traffic to identified C2 infrastructure (e.g., 65.222.202.53 and 8.222.206.6); the findings underscore growing exploitation of routers, VPNs, and firewalls and recommend treating network devices as critical endpoints for monitoring and detection.
